I can't tell if it is my connection, my ISP or something else. My phone has a lot of static, I keep getting cut off from the internet, and my connection which is supposed to be 56K is coming in at 26400bps.
I just wonder where the problem is. I would really appreciate any help or advice.

Could be a few things:
1. your ISP. Many ISP's have trouble handling the extra user load on Sunday nights. This would explain why you aren't getting a full 56k connection. If you keep getting cut off, and then get a busy signal when trying to log on again, this could be it.
2. the weather. If there is a storm anywhere between you and your ISP, this can affect the signal.
3. line noise. This can be caused either by a problem with your interior lines or with the outside phone lines. Call your phone company tomorrow and they may be able to run a test to find out which it is.
